最近要实现一个文件上传,并且在线预览上传文件的功能,设计思路是:把上传的文件通过openoffice转成pdf文件,并将pdf文件以流的形式返回到浏览器,由于上传的部分文件过大,转成pdf后传回前端浏览器需要的时间太长会找出接口超时问题,故需要对转化后的pdf文件进行压缩,分割再分页传回到前台。 在网上
转载
2023-08-14 21:21:38
249阅读
前言最近遇到的需求,把html转成pdf文件下载导出。 目前网上看了下,有三种方法,但是其中两种需要后端配合 一种是纯前端实现的,比较简单。所以就使用了这种。 也就是html2canvas + jspdf 的这种方法 这种方法实现的思路就是,通过html2canvas 把元素内的数据截图出来成一个图片 然后把这个图片通过jspdf 方法转成pdf格式输出出来 但是也有缺点,就是只是一个图片,而且清
转载
2023-11-06 12:16:19
266阅读
java发送http请求,解析html返回的技术,主要是用于抓取网站数据。思路: java通过URLConnection链接目的地网址,链接成功后从inputStream中获取返回的html内容,获取后就可以按照正则匹配的方式或者第三方工具,根据页面信息的规律来分析数据获取数据。 反制措施: 谁的网站都不想让别人轻易
转载
2023-06-20 02:19:59
70阅读
# 从PDF解析为String的流程
## 1. 理解PDF的结构
首先需要了解PDF的结构,PDF是一种复杂的文档格式,由多个对象组成,包括文本、图片等。在Java中,我们可以使用开源库iText来处理PDF文档。
## 2. 使用iText库进行解析
我们可以通过iText库来实现将PDF解析为String的功能。下面是整个过程的步骤表格:
```mermaid
journey
原创
2024-03-27 05:37:37
91阅读
# Java 导出 PDF 解析 HTML 标签
在现代开发中,许多应用程序需要将 HTML 内容导出为 PDF 格式。例如,生成发票、报告或任何其他需要以可打印形式呈现的文档。这篇文章将介绍如何使用 Java 导出 PDF,并解析 HTML 标签,提供代码示例以及实际应用场景。
## 1. 准备工作
我们需要几个库来完成这个任务:
- **iText**:一个流行的 PDF 库,用于创建
# Java将Word解析为HTML的实现
在许多应用场景中,我们需要将Word文档转换为HTML格式,以便在网页上显示。Java为我们提供了多种操作文档的库,其中Apache POI库非常适合处理Word文件。本文将详细介绍如何使用Java将Word文档解析为HTML,并提供完整的代码示例。
## Apache POI介绍
Apache POI是一个Java库,用于操作各种Microsof
原创
2024-09-23 03:58:53
109阅读
1. 模板编译器如果用户提供的options并没有render函数,则查找其携带的template字段提供的模板串,模板编译器则完成字符串解析成ast语法树的核心工具,关于AST语法树,编译器将在AST语法树上标记各种关键信息 e.g: filter,text等标记所谓的服务端喧嚷就是在服务端调用编译器执行编译输出相应render函数的一个过程,这样处理之后前端Vue库文件就不用携带编译器相关的源
转载
2023-07-24 15:07:16
0阅读
一、安装// 第一个.将页面html转换成图片
npm install --save html2canvas
// 第二个.将图片生成pdf
npm install jspdf --save二、htmlToPdf.js或者htmlToPdfJQ.js/* eslint-disable */
//不使用JQuery版的
import html2canvas from 'html2canvas';
i
转载
2023-10-01 21:42:09
182阅读
这个资料是普通html的(比较原生老旧,此博客写于2018年),如果你用Vue.js开发的话,推荐用vue下载pdf,网上已经有很多关于vue下载pdf的资料了。1、简单描述最近做了一个项目,我也是刚学js才几个多月,对js不是很懂,但是我相信,只要肯学,总会进步的。项目里面要实现把网页的试题下载成pdf,所以我有个同事就实现了这个功能,然后我参考着他写的代码就总结了一下。网页渲染的过
转载
2023-12-13 20:05:04
95阅读
做网页的朋友们每天都需要敲代码通过编写html语言并进行多次调试网站内容把才能把一个完美的网站呈现在我们面前,而对于一个小白来说从无基础到能自行制作一个网页花费的时间少说也要3个月,而且在学习的过程中会遇到很多的PDF素材,但是想直接运用这些pdf是不可能的,所以今天跟大家分享的就是如何将pdf转换成html格式。将pdf转换成html格式是有一定难度的,所以建议大家下载迅捷pdf格式转换器,以便
转载
2023-10-20 19:47:14
45阅读
最近做项目涉及到了合同的签订,原来用的wordxml格式的ftl模板转doc来完成的合同的签署,但是想在公司新需求需要以html格式的模板可以在线编辑合同,这样原来的模式就已经不适合了,在网上查了查,结果发现了wkhtmltopdf,下面就是我用的一些心得分享给大家。1.准备工作因为wkhtmltopdf为一个软件,所以我们应该先下载并安装。win7 64位linux 64位window安装就不用
转载
2023-09-24 21:26:29
108阅读
作为开发人员,如何让PDF输出看起来更专业?大多数免费的在线PDF导出器实际上只是将HTML内容转换为PDF,而不进行任何额外的格式化,这会使数据难以阅读。如果你也能添加诸如页眉和页脚、页码或重复的表列标题等内容呢?像这样的小点缀,对把一份看起来很业余的文件变成一份优雅的文件有很大的帮助。最近,我探索了几种生成PDF的解决方案,并建立了这个Demo程序来展示结果。所有的代码也可以在Github上找
# Java解析字符串为HTML
## 1. 概述
在Java中,解析字符串为HTML的过程主要分为以下几步:
1. 将字符串转化为HTML文档对象模型(DOM)。
2. 遍历DOM,并根据DOM中的元素类型和属性,生成相应的HTML标签。
3. 将生成的HTML标签输出为字符串。
本文将详细介绍每一步的具体实现过程,并提供相应的代码示例。
## 2. 流程
下面是将字符串解析为HTM
原创
2023-10-20 11:56:47
64阅读
# Python解析HTML为JSON
## 介绍
在开发过程中,我们经常需要从HTML中提取数据,并将其转换为JSON格式以便进行进一步处理。本文将教会你如何使用Python解析HTML,并将其转换为JSON。
## 流程图
以下是整个过程的流程图:
```mermaid
graph LR
A[读取HTML文件] --> B[解析HTML]
B --> C[提取数据]
C --> D[转换
原创
2023-11-11 04:21:37
202阅读
XPCOM运用.NET Framework类来解析HTML文件、读取数据并不是最容易的。虽然你可以用.NET Framework中的许多类(如StreamReader)来逐行解析文件,但XmlReader提供的API并不是“取出即可用(out of the box)”的,因为HTML的格式不规范。你可以用正则表达式(regular expression),但如果你对这些表达式运用不熟练,你可能开始
转载
2024-09-23 09:50:08
48阅读
Python xml 模块TOC什么是xml?xml和json的区别xml现今的应用xml的解析方式
xml.etree.ElementTreeSAX(xml.parsers.expat)DOM修改xml构建xml什么是xml? 我的理解是,xml存储着数据,是一种数据结构,结构化的存储着数据(已标签为节点的树形结构) 就像字典、列表一样,都是一种特定的数据结构。 只不过字典、列表是pyt
python转html页面为pdf:安装wkhtmltopdf略apt-getinstallpython-pippipinstallpdfkitviaa.py#!/usr/bin/pythonimportpdfkitpdfkit.from_url('http://google.com','baidu.pdf'):wqpythonaa.pypdfkit.from_st
原创
2018-10-19 20:16:58
1912阅读
# Python String 解析为 HTML:从小白到大师的指南
在当今的编程世界中,将数据格式进行转换是一个常见的需求。对于一些开发者而言,尤其是刚入行的小白,可能会对如何将 Python 字符串解析为 HTML 感到困惑。在这篇文章中,我们将详细介绍整个流程,并逐步引导你完成这个任务。
## 整体流程
首先,我们需要明确将字符串转换为 HTML 的整体步骤。以下是整个过程的概述:
这里的问题是XML中唯一有效的助记符是“amp”,“lt”和“”.这意味着几乎所有(X)HTML命名实体必须使用XML 1.1 spec中定义的
entity declaration markup在DTD中定义.如果文档是独立的,则应使用内联DTD完成此操作:
]>
1 >
2008©
141100xml.etree.ElementTree中的XMLParser使用xml.parser
转载
2024-07-15 16:58:06
32阅读
对于java中如何从html中直接导出pdf,有很多的开源代码,这里个人用itext转。首先需要的包有:core-renderer-1.0.jar core-renderer-R8pre1.jar core-renderer.jar iText-2.0.8.jar jtidy-4aug2000r7-dev.jar Tidy.jar iTextAsian.jarjava代码的话就比较简单了。具体是
转载
2023-07-12 14:37:59
408阅读